2013-02-13 2 views
0

DMG 파일 (http://dev.mysql.com/downloads/mysql/)을 사용하여 MySQL을 설치했으며 MySQL_etc.pkg, MySQLStartUpItem.pkg 및 MySQL.prefPane 항목을 설치했습니다.MySQL 서버 인스턴스가 절대로 시작되지 않습니다. Mac OS Lion

나는이 메시지가 명령 줄에서 MySQL을 시작하려고 할 때마다 : 나는 MySQL이 실행되지 않았기 때문에이 것을 발견 유래에 대한 다양한 게시물

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/mysql/mysql.sock' (2) 

감사합니다. 그래서 나는 시스템 환경 설정의 MySQL 패널로 가서 "The MySQL Server Instance is stopped"을 충분히 확인한다. "Start MySQL Server"를 클릭하면 2 분 동안 회전하는 비치볼이 생기고 아무 일도 일어나지 않습니다. MySQL 서버 인스턴스는 멈추지 않습니다.

컴퓨터를 다시 시작하면 MySQL 창으로 이동하여 "The MySQL Server Instance is running"이라고 표시됩니다. 그리고 확실하게 명령 줄에서 mysql -v은 내 MySQL 연결 ID를 알려주고 서버 버전 5.6.10을 가지고 있습니다. 하지만 exit를 입력하여 mysql을 종료하면 서버 인스턴스가 중지되고 컴퓨터를 다시 시작해야만 다시 시작할 수 있습니다!

아이디어가 있으십니까? 필자는 암호를 설정하기 위해 오랫동안 MySQL을 실행할 수 없었고, 데이터베이스를 만들었습니다.

답변

2

시도 :

prompt$ sudo mysqld -u root <secure password goes here!> 

참고 sudo를 : MySQL이 나 컴퓨터와 MySQL 자체 모두에 대한 루트 액세스 권한이없는 서버를 시작하지 것이다. 또한이 프로그램은 mysql이 아니라 mysqld이다.

명령은 MySQL 설치 방법에 따라 다릅니다. 당신이 MAMP와 PHP로 작업하는 경우이 시도 '나는를 havent

cd /usr/local/mysql 
sudo ./bin/mysqld_safe 
(Enter your password, if necessary) 
(Press Control-Z) 
bg 

을하지만,이 체크 아웃 : 그 실패 할 경우

sudo /Library/StartupItems/MySQLCOM/MySQLCOM start 

을 :이 첫 번째 시도 -

http://twob.net/journal/fix-for-mamp-mysql/

어쩌면 다시 설치해보고 다음 문서를 따르십시오. -

또한

이 페이지에 브레인 스토밍의 많은 : -

거짓 리드의 오후 후 https://stackoverflow.com/questions/4788381/getting-cant-connect-through-socket-tmp-mysql-when-installing-mysql-on-m

3

(내가 은혜를 모르는 소리를 의미하지 않는다, 모든 제안을 추적 관찰하고 난 모든 조언에 감사드립니다), 나는이 블로그의 조언에 따라 MySQL의 모든 흔적을 제거하고 이전 버전을 다시 설치했습니다 : http://soatechlab.blogspot.com/2011/01/completely-remove-mysql-on-mac-os-x.html

지금은 작동 중입니다.

+0

당신이 알아 낸 것을 기쁘게 생각합니다! – Philo

+0

감사합니다 !!!!!!!!! – user1338194